Bonnie Kaye and Dari hosts of Military Author Radio are delighted to bring back Author DM Ulmer, a former commander of the USS Clamagore Submarine.  Captain Ulmer plans to discuss his newest novel, Ensure Plausible Deniability, and his recent presentation Voices of the Great War at the Seattle Museum of Flight.  Producer Ed Bradley Jr. will be reading passages from Silent Battleground, Shadows of Heroes and Count the Ways for our listeners enjoyment.To learn more about Captain Don Ulmer, USN (RET.) visit www.dmulmer.com in advance of the program.

DM Ulmer has written 8 books:  Silent Battleground, Shadows of Heroes, The Cold War Beneath, Ensure Plausible Deniability, Count the Ways, Where or When, Missing Persons, The Roche Harbor Caper and the Long Beach Caper.

DM Ulmers titles are published and distributed internationally in softcover print copies, and also available as Ebooks on Amazon Kindle.
